Summary
Photograph, 2m Sculpture of Edward Gordon Craig (1872-1966) inscribed "Ted"
Provenance
Photograph believed to have been owned by, or given to, EllenTerry (1847-1928) or her daughter Edith Craig (1869-1947) and came to National Trust in 1939 when Edith Craig transferred to Smallhythe Place (including buildings, land and contents) to the Trust
